Transaction 91e8aa9b61fc050bb10c2290e1e5baeac40398e109cb24c2b4419418d4f164a3
1 Input
1 Output
-
91e8aa9b61fc050bb10c2290e1e5baeac40398e109cb24c2b4419418d4f164a3:0
- value
- 2472756
- script pubkey
- OP_0 OP_PUSHBYTES_32 0c694253b78a0f7b6438e2f7cf524eaee0d615b248a213e14ebf304a5da88500
- address
- bc1qp355y5ah3g8hkepcutmu75jw4msdv9djfz3p8c2whucy5hdgs5qq7axf0r